Проблема с кодировкой при преобразовании файла .txt в файл .xml - PullRequest
0 голосов
/ 21 июля 2011

У меня есть файл .txt, в котором более 10000 строк, и мое требование - преобразовать каждую строку в файл XML. Кодировка XML-файла iso-8859-1. Все преобразуется должным образом, кроме «ПРОСТРАНСТВА НЕТРУШЕНИЯ», которое напоминает пространство, но не является реальным пространством. Он преобразуется в какой-то другой символ (A с крышкой). С помощью XML Writer и потокового писателя я использую только кодировку iso-8859-1.

Пожалуйста, помогите мне решить эту проблему.

1 Ответ

0 голосов
/ 21 июля 2011

Если в txt-файле содержится больше символов, чем в iso-8859-1, вы не сможете сделать это, не потеряв информацию.

Либо переключитесь на Unicode, либо требуйте txt-файл в iso-8859-1.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...